Key Replacement

Car locksmiths are frequently asked to reprogram or replace car keys, remotes and FOBs. The procedure of programming a key or FOB usually involves connecting the device to the OBD port on your car (commonly located below the dashboard). The device then transmits information from the system to the car, allowing you to start your vehicle. Based on the brand and model of your vehicle the remote or key may require a different set of technology to operate. Locksmiths make use of special equipment and software to program all models.

Car keys have a lot of moving parts, making them susceptible to break. They also become stuck in locks. You can contact locksmiths to remove the broken piece of your key from the lock. You might be tempted attempt this yourself, but this is not a smart idea. You could damage the cylinder of your ignition or the lock if you try to pull the key out by hand.

You might also need to get a new key in case your old one has been lost or damaged. Getting a copy from your dealership can be expensive but the locksmith is a cheaper option. The locksmith will need the make and model of your car, as well as proof that you are its owner of the vehicle.

Some motorists prefer using their key fob instead of a traditional car key to open their car and start it. This is fine, however it isn't easy to find an replacement in the event that you lose it. A locksmith can assist with this, since they can create duplicates of your existing key fob and program it to work with your vehicle.

You can also use the key fob replicating machine which is available at some hardware stores. They are quite simple to use and are a cheap alternative to going to the dealer. However, they are not always accurate and might not be able to duplicate all types of key fobs.

Key Fob Replacement

Replacing key fobs is one of the most popular locksmith services offered by car. These are the tiny remotes that unlock your doors, and occasionally start the engine. Like any other high-tech device they may stop working or even break at any point. Fortunately, the most common problem is usually an unresponsive battery, which can be fixed by replacing a new one. Other issues could require more extensive repairs or replacement.

A car locksmith can reprogram your new key fob to work with your vehicle. If you've lost yours or the fob was damaged by heat, water or other environmental factors, this is a great idea. The majority of auto locksmiths use OEM models. Some companies produce aftermarket fobs which function exactly like the ones that came with your vehicle. They are built to specific sizes and specifications that guarantee they'll function with your specific model of automobile.

A lot of people resort to the dealership for help when they're having issues with their key fob but this isn't always a great alternative. The positive side is that many car locksmiths have the necessary tools to program a replacement much less than what you would pay at a dealer.

Some replacement fobs have a hidden mechanical key that can be used in an emergency to unlock the car's door and then start the motor. This is especially helpful if the batteries in your fob fail or if you accidentally lock your keys inside the car.

Car Door Lock Repair

When car locks fail it could be stressful, or even dangerous. Locksmiths for cars are trained to assess and fix problems quickly, without causing more damage. The best option in an emergency situation is to call your roadside assistance provider or insurance company to find a local locksmith. They can provide an approved list of car locksmiths. The idea of tackling the issue by yourself might appear as if it will save you money, but it could cost more in the long run in the event you fail to solve the problem.

If your power door locks aren't working, you should replace the actuator. It's priced at around $50 and comes with a key as well as retainer clips. The locksmith will have to remove the door panel and Www.elsycrays.Top then detach the door lock cylinder to install the new actuator. They may also need to remove the locking mechanism that requires a specific tool.

The keyhole of a manual doorlock can also become jammed by rust and dirt. A reputable locksmith can spray the mechanism with lubricant and aid in getting it unlocked.
